  1. This 1927 Paige Coupe has been in the family for 50+ years and was my dad's restoration project. Unfortunately he passed before completing it. It will be up for auction May 22 in Cumberland, WI. Many parts restored and bright work re-chromed. Rolling chassis is reassembled with freshly rebuilt engine, brakes, shocks, etc. Body metal is in excellent condition. Many wood sub-frame components are new. There are also lots of duplicate parts he accumulated. A complete photo catalog will be available on bidbidauctions.com.
